Ireland has some of the most beautiful expressions of Christmas.
Join Dr. Miriam O'Regan as she explains her experience growing up in Ireland from the food they ate to their special "women's Christmas." It's no joke! The day is called "Nollaig na mBan” and it is celebrated on January 6th as a way of saying thank you for all the many things the women did to make the holiday season special.

Invisibility persists throughout the Asian American story.
Grace Ji-Sun Kim shares her experience as a Koren woman growing up Asian in the western world. On the one hand, xenophobia has long contributed to racism and discrimination toward Asian Americans. On the other hand, terms such as perpetual foreigner and honorific whites have been thrust upon Asian Americans, minimizing their plight with racism and erasing their experience as racial minorities. Grace Ji-Sun Kim shares this and more in her book "Invisible."
The compounded effects of a patriarchal Asian culture and a marginalizing American culture are formidable, steadily removing the recognition of these women's lives, voices, and agency.

Women have always played pivotal leadership roles in serving the mission of the Church.
The New Testament provides ample evidence of this important reality. Women depicted in the art of early church structures also support this historical fact. Since the First Council of Nicaea through the 12th century, there are depictions of women preaching, women marked as clergy, and even one carrying a Communion chalice.
In this episode, Lynn Cohick talks with Dr. Sandra Glahn about her discoveries and the work she is doing to make this history more accessible to church leaders.

The topic of women's role in ministry can often be a contentious conversation. Sue Edwards and Kelley Mathews approach the topic with the goal of bringing more light and less heat to the conversation.
They put together a straightforward Q&A guide to women in ministry. In this book they cover questions like:
- What did God mean by the woman as man's "helper"?
- How is it that Christians reach different conclusions about 1 Timothy 2:11-15?
- How did Western culture influence the role of women in society and the church?
Lynn talks with Sue and Kelley about their new book and how it can be used by all.

Women have been leading in Christianity from the start.
For centuries, discussions of early Christianity have focused on male leaders in the church. But there is ample evidence right in the New Testament that women were actively involved in ministry, at the frontier of the gospel mission, and as respected leaders.
In this episode of Alabaster Jar, Nijay Gupta calls us to bring these women out of the shadows by shining light on their many inspiring contributions to the planting, growth, and health of the first Christian churches. He sets the context by exploring the lives of first-century women and addressing common misconceptions, then focuses on the women leaders of the early churches as revealed in Paul’s writings.

In this special broadcast of Kingdom Roots with Scot McKnight, we highlight the exceptional work by Lisa Bowens on the Apostle Paul.
In African American Readings of Paul, she surveys a wealth of primary sources from the early 1700s to the mid-twentieth century, including sermons, conversion stories, slave petitions, and autobiographies of ex-slaves, many of which introduce readers to previously unknown names in the history of New Testament interpretation. Along with their hermeneutical value, these texts also provide fresh documentation of Black religious life through wide swaths of American history. African American Readings of Paul promises to change the landscape of Pauline studies and fill an important gap in the rising field of reception history.
